Ibtissem Ben Fekih is a scholar working on Insect Science, Plant Science and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Ibtissem Ben Fekih has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 526 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Insect Science, 11 papers in Plant Science and 9 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Ibtissem Ben Fekih’s work include Entomopathogenic Microorganisms in Pest Control (9 papers), Insect Resistance and Genetics (8 papers) and Insect symbiosis and bacterial influences (7 papers). Ibtissem Ben Fekih is often cited by papers focused on Entomopathogenic Microorganisms in Pest Control (9 papers), Insect Resistance and Genetics (8 papers) and Insect symbiosis and bacterial influences (7 papers). Ibtissem Ben Fekih collaborates with scholars based in China, Belgium and Denmark. Ibtissem Ben Fekih's co-authors include Christopher Rensing, Yuan Ping Li, Chengkang Zhang, Carlos Cervantes, Hend A. Alwathnani, Quaiser Saquib, Yi Zhao, Rubab Sarfraz, Shihe Xing and Allah Ditta and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Pollution, Annual Review of Microbiology and Frontiers in Microbiology.
